Excerpt from Loose Sketches, an Eastern Adventure, Etc How he overlooked the existence of the other papers, with the key to their discovery in his possession, is not the least remarkable circumstance in the story of The Britannia. It was not, in fact, till towards the end of 189 3 - more than two years later - that the remaining sketches were brought to light.
